    Since you didn't post a reference to the OS X Hints article it's hard to tell what you may have done wrong. When you post a problem you need to provide complete information.
    That said you shouldn't have to do anything special except to be sure you properly partition and format the flash device:
    Extended Hard Drive Preparation
    1. Open Disk Utility.
    2. After DU loads select your flash drive (this is the entry with the mfgr.'s ID and size) from the left side list. Click on the Partition tab in the DU main window.
    3. Click on the Options button and be sure to select the APM partition scheme then click on the OK button. Set the number of partitions from the dropdown menu (use 1 partition only.) Set the format type to Mac OS Extended (Journaled.) Click on the Partition button and wait until the volume mounts on the Desktop.
    4. Select the volume you just created (this is the sub-entry under the drive entry) from the left side list. Click on the Erase tab in the DU main window.
    5. Set the format type to Mac OS Extended (Journaled.) Click on the Options button, check the button for Zero Data and click on OK to return to the Erase window.
    6. Click on the Erase button. The format process will take 30 minutes to an hour or more depending upon the drive size.
    After formatting has completed you can install OS X and then upgrade it to 10.4.10. That should be all you need do. Now open the Startup Disk preference pane, select the icon of the flash drive, then click on the Restart button.

  • Hi, I have a late 2008 iMac with a new hard drive. How do I install Mountain Lion from my bootable USB flash drive.

    How do I install Mountain Lion to a new hard drive without having the recovery partition on it.
    I have the USB flash drive with software on it but when I switch my Mac on all I have is a white screen & a flashing question mark.
    ATB,
    Steve.

    Did you use LionDiskMaker or DiskMaker X?
    Boot the machine with the option key down until you see your bootable USB stick.  Select the latter, and reboot.
    When the installer boots up, you will first need to choose Utilities and Disk Utility. Select the target HD device name and then the partition tab. Select 1 partition, name it Macintosh HD. Format is Mac OS Extended, and option is GUID. Apply. Exit Disk Utility and return to the installer, which will now show your newly partitioned HD as available for install.
    When OS X is installed and all updates applied, press shift+command+U and run disk utility again. Verify/repair permissions and verify the boot disk.

  • USB Flash drive will only work on the Mac

    I have a Toshiba 32 GB flash drive and tried to copy music to it. The music plays thru my Mac but when I put the drive into my Subaru or Sony amplifier I get the message that the drive is unrecognized. I tried to partition it with the same results.  Is there a certain partition to use? I have tried all that were offered in Disc Utility.

    From a subaru forum "Zero problems using 16gb SanDisk Cruzer USB 2.0 Flash drives in whatever head unit is in a non-nav"
    It may depends what head unit you have, same for the sony amplifier, many units cannot read over 8 or 16gb, try a different / smaller usb and give it a go.  Also maybe try formatting your stick at work or a friends computer to fat16
